Rock garden construction services involve designing and building decorative outdoor spaces that incorporate natural stones, rocks, and other landscape elements to enhance the appearance and functionality of a property. These services typically include selecting appropriate materials, planning the layout, and installing features such as rock walls, pathways, retaining walls, and ornamental rock arrangements. The goal is to create visually appealing landscapes that blend seamlessly with the existing environment while providing practical benefits like erosion control and defining different areas within a yard.
This type of construction helps address common landscape challenges such as soil erosion, uneven terrain, and drainage issues. When a property experiences water runoff problems or has slopes that need stabilization, a rock garden can serve as an effective solution. Additionally, homeowners looking to add a natural aesthetic or create low-maintenance outdoor spaces often turn to rock garden construction. These features can also serve as focal points or borders, adding structure and visual interest to gardens, patios, or yards.

The overview below groups typical Rock Garden Construction proj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in State College,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or rock garden repairs or touch-ups range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the scope of work and materials needed.
Mid-Range Projects - Larger installations or extensive landscaping can c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to enhance their outdoor space with more detailed designs.
Full Replacement - Replacing an existing rock garden or undertaking a significant redesign often costs $4,000 to $8,000. Such projects are less frequent but are typical for complete overhauls or large-scale landscaping efforts.
Complex or Custom Work - Highly customized or intricate rock garden projects can exceed $10,000, with larger, more complex projects reaching $20,000 or more. These tend to be less common and involve specialized features or extensive site preparation.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of rock are used in garden rock installations? Local contractors often work with a variety of rocks such as limestone, sandstone, granite, and river rocks to create durable and attractive garden features.
Can rock gardens be integrated into existing landscaping? Yes, experienced service providers can incorporate rock features into existing landscapes to enhance visual appeal and complement other garden elements.
What are the benefits of choosing a rock garden for landscaping? Rock gardens require minimal maintenance, add natural beauty, and can help with erosion control when designed properly by local contractors.
How do professionals prepare the site for a rock garden installation? Local service providers typically clear the area, level the ground, and create a stable base to ensure the longevity and stability of the rock features.
Are there different styles of rock gardens offered by local contractors? Yes, contractors can craft a variety of styles, from naturalistic arrangements to structured, geometric designs, tailored to suit individual preferences.
